- The distance between Guaramiranga, Brazil and Hobart, Tasmania, Australia is approximately 14,731 km or 9,154 mi.
- To reach Guaramiranga in this distance one would set out from Hobart, Tasmania bearing 171.4° or S and follow the great circles arc to approach Guaramiranga bearing 6.3° or N .
- Guaramiranga has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am) whereas Hobart, Tasmania has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Guaramiranga is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Hobart, Tasmania is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 7.7 °C (13.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.9 °C (12.4°F) less in Guaramiranga.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1087.7 mm (42.8 in) more which is equivalent to 1087.7 l/m² (26.69 US gal/ft²) or 10,877,000 l/ha (1,162,823 US gal/ac) more. About 2 6/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 27.8° higher in Guaramiranga than in Hobart, Tasmania.
- Relative humidity levels are 24%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 12.6°C (22.6°F) higher.
